          Nancy Lopez's Biography

          American golfer and entrepreneur, a Ladies Professional Golf Association (LPGA) Hall of Fame member and a world class athlete, the winner of countless championships.
          Raised in Roswell, NM and taught golf at age eight by her dad, Domingo, she won her first tournament the following year and the New Mexico Women’s Amateur Championship at 12. She won the USGA Junior Girls Championship in 1972 and 1974. In 1975, as an entrant in the U.S. Women’s Open as an amateur, she finished in a tie for second. While attending the University of Tulsa she was a member of the U.S. Curtis Cup and World Amateur teams. Lopez turned professional after her sophomore year of college in 1977.
          She won her first tournament as a pro in Sarasota, FL. Changing the face of women’s golf in 1978 she had a record nine rookie Tour victories including an unmatched streak of five in a row. Lopez won five events in 1985, including the LPGA Championship, with 21 top ten finishes in 25 starts. An LPGA Player of the Year four times, 1978-79, 1985 and 1988, she entered the Hall of Fame in 1987, as the youngest player ever after just ten years on Tour. She has won the Vare Trophy for lowest scoring average three times in 1978, 1979 and 1985. She appeared on Kellogg’s Product 19 golf star series boxes in 1997.
          In 1998 she was the recipient of the U.S. Golf Association’s Bob Jones Award which recognizes distinguished sportsmanship in the game of golf. As of the beginning of 1999 she had 48 Tour titles. She is 5’5″ with brown hair, brown eyes and the attitude of a champion, extroverted personality and a cool temperament, playing a devastatingly accurate short game. Her good health and strength have helped her earn over $5 million. Founder and principal of the Nancy Lopez Golf Company, she is a commercial representative of Sara Lee. She has four lines of golf clubs specifically designed for women and girls. Lopez has a video on the market, “Nancy Lopez: Golf Made Easy.”
          Marrying former baseball great, Ray Knight, on 10/29/82, they now live in Albany, GA. They have three daughters, Ashley Marie 11/07/83, Erinn Shea 5/26/86 and Torri Heather 10/30/91. They enjoy hunting, fishing and golf; they don’t drink, smoke or party.
